[发明专利]Web服务组合的参数自适应小生境差分进化方法在审
申请号: | 201810349114.5 | 申请日: | 2018-04-18 |
公开(公告)号: | CN108512707A | 公开(公告)日: | 2018-09-07 |
发明(设计)人: | 周井泉;李强;张严凯;许杰 | 申请(专利权)人: | 南京邮电大学;南京邮电大学南通研究院有限公司 |
主分类号: | H04L12/24 | 分类号: | H04L12/24;H04L29/08;G06N3/12 |
代理公司: | 南京正联知识产权代理有限公司 32243 | 代理人: | 王素琴 |
地址: | 210023 ***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 小生境 子种群 算法 进化 参数自适应 优选 差分进化算法 模糊专家系统 算法迭代过程 初始种群 服务需求 交叉操作 快速稳定 评价指标 使用参数 缩放因子 贪婪算法 自适应 求解 迭代 重置 收敛 种群 优化 | ||
本发明公布了一种Web服务组合的优化方法,依据用户的服务需求,采用参数自适应小生境差分进化方法,快速稳定地得到体验质量高的Web服务组合的优选结果。首先建立一个基于体验质量QoE评价指标的模糊专家系统模型,并使用参数自适应小生境差分进化算法求解,该算法将初始种群划分为若干子种群,对各个子种群中优秀个体之间小于小生境半径的个体进行重置,让所有子种群的个体在各自的环境中进化迭代;对种群中个体进行变异、交叉操作,利用贪婪算法进行优选成员,在算法迭代过程中动态地调节缩放因子和交叉率,提高算法的收敛速度和算法的稳定性。
技术领域
本发明设计Web服务组合领域,具体涉及Web服务组合的参数自适应小生境差分进化方法。
背景技术
随着Web服务相关标准的持续完善,越来越多的Web服务在网上共享,然而单个Web服务功能有限,很难满足实际需求,因此需要将共享的Web服务组合起来,增强Web服务的能力。Web服务组合的研究在这种背景下被提出,并吸引了工商界和学术界的广泛关注。
目前广泛采用的服务度量标准为QoS(Quality of Service),QoS评价指标主要包括信誉度、可用性、成本费用、响应时间等。但这只仅仅反映了服务技术方面的特性,用户的主观方面被忽略了,所以不能够反映用户对服务的满意程度。体验质量(Quality ofExperience,QoE)是凭借用户满意程度来作为评价标准的。它结合了网络性能、业务质量、主观评测等影响因素,直接反映了用户对服务舒适度的满意程度。Web服务组合的实质为NP难问题,目前主流的算法是智能优化算法。差分进化算法具有高可靠性、强鲁棒性以及良好的优化性能,但同时也有早熟收敛和搜索停滞的缺点。
发明内容
本发明针对上述问题,提出Web服务组合的参数自适应小生境差分进化方法,在标准差分进化算法的基础之上,引入小生境淘汰策略和参数自适应不仅能避免标准差分进化算法本身的缺点还能提高其算法的性能和稳定性。
本发明提出的Web服务组合的参数自适应小生境差分进化方法,包括如下步骤:
(1)建立Web服务组合优化整体模型:把用户需求分解为各个子服务,依据Web服务组合的评价模型,将资源库中对应的各个子服务的QoS,转化为体验质量(Quality ofExperience,QoE),依此求出适应度函数,对Web子服务的组合进行优化,将优化的服务提供给用户,该适应度函数为:
(2)设置控制参数:种群规模
(4)对种群中所有个体进行适应度值评估,然后将初始化种群划分为
(5)对种群进行RCS小生境淘汰策略;具体步骤如下:
(5-3):重新在子种群中寻找最优个体,转向步骤(5-1);
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南京邮电大学;南京邮电大学南通研究院有限公司,未经南京邮电大学;南京邮电大学南通研究院有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810349114.5/2.html,转载请声明来源钻瓜专利网。